31,606,894 is a composite number, even.
31,606,894 (thirty-one million six hundred six thousand eight hundred ninety-four) is an even 8-digit number. It is a composite number with 24 divisors, and factors as 2 × 11² × 131 × 997. Written other ways, in hexadecimal, 0x1E2486E.
